This is actually my 2nd order. My first was the coupon you get with membership, and I used it on 4 mid-grade silver age comics. I didn't stress about the grades because I knew they were no better than VG/FN or so.

 

With this order, though, I submitted 10 comics all published in 2012. To my eye they all look perfect, and I'm hoping to get at least 9.8 with all. I'm stressed because a subset of my collection is modern comics all CGC 9.8s or better. I pick them solely by whether or not I like the cover, and so far I've got about 30 of them all purchased through ebay. This is the first time I've tried to add to this collection by buying raw via ebay and then submitting to CGC.

 

I'm already wondering what I'll do if some come back less than 9.8. What's worst, 6 of the ten are a variant cover set. What if 4 come back at 9.8 and the other 2 at 9.4 or 9.6? Do I sell the 9.4/9.6s and go back to ebay for 9.8s to complete the set (and these comics at CGC 9.8 are expensive on ebay right now, and according to the census only 3 of the 6 have been graded -- that's why I decided to go this raw -> cgc route).

 

At least I won't have too long too wait to find out (hopefully), as I spent the extra money to go Modern Fast track.
